所以我想要完成的就是这个;我有人打电话给潜在客户。当打电话的人打电话给潜在客户并让他们感兴趣时,他们会将客户转给销售代理,以达成交易。
在最初的对话中,冷来电者会收集我在线表格中的一些信息,如姓名、电话号码、地址等。我需要冷来电者能够在他们通过电话时将这些值传递给销售代理。
冷漠的来电者和销售代理住在镇对面的两栋不同的大楼里,销售代理也使用在线表格收集数据。获取值不是问题,而是我无法理解的从一个代理到另一个代理的传递。
我想冷调用方可能会将表单发布到谷歌电子表格中,但我不知道如何在调用传递时将这些值填充到第二个表单中。我需要在几秒钟内完成传输,所以在电子邮件中发送带有捕获值的URL是不可行的,因为速度部门的电子邮件不可靠。
有人对此有什么想法吗?我可以使用HTML、jQuery或其他任何东西。如果必须在AJAX中完成,我将需要帮助。。。。
谢谢!
好的。
这是客户端:
客户将数据放入表单,并将这些数据发送到服务器。服务器必须为代理保存此数据。
这是代理方:
浏览器向客户发送新数据的检查请求(可能是自动的,也可能是代理需要点击一些按钮)。若存在新的数据,你们应该把这些数据放到代理页面的表单中。
$('#first-form').submit(function() {
$.post('/another-destination', $(this).serialize(), function(r) {
alert('Data sended to another destination!');
});
return true;
});
看起来您想要使用HTML5和JavascriptWebSockets以便能够将D_1数据从一个浏览器push
到另一个浏览器。
Ajax需要polling
,这意味着查询必须向服务器请求新信息。这可以通过保存和比较会话变量中最后更新的时间戳来实现。
Websockets在更新时将push
数据发送给连接的对等方,从而允许数据在提交时自动填充,非常像实时聊天系统。
如果你一直使用PHP,你应该看看Ratchet,因为与许多替代方案相比,它的实现相当简单和简约。
http://socketo.me/
使用棘轮的聊天演示http://socketo.me/demo
添加RDBMS来创建、读取和更新数据,您就拥有了一个强大的实时应用程序。